NASA's Swift Observatory Rescue: A Race Against Time (2026)

NASA's Swift Observatory, a 21-year-old satellite, is on a perilous descent, threatening to crash back to Earth. The situation is dire, and a team of engineers and scientists is racing against time to save it. The mission, led by Katalyst Space Technologies, involves a complex robotic rescue attempt, a first-of-its-kind endeavor. The challenge is twofold: the satellite was never designed for such a mission, and the team has a tight deadline of just nine months to launch the rescue mission before Swift's altitude falls too low for a safe rendezvous.

The Swift Observatory, launched in 2004, has been a valuable asset in detecting gamma-ray bursts, powerful explosions in the universe. Its unique ability to quickly turn towards gamma-ray sources has made it indispensable for astrophysicists. However, without a reboost, Swift will likely crash, and its loss would be a significant setback for scientific research.

Katalyst's Link spacecraft, a robotic servicing platform, will attempt to dock with Swift and raise its altitude.
